I am by no means an authority on this but I have spent some time interpreting the AM comments and strongly believe the following:

"We're misplacing way to many easy passes" - means lower tempo ie. take more time and care over your passes :thup:

I think that tactical advice regarding your width setting comes from your scout, not from the AM during the game - so make sure you are scouting your next opposition

Any AM comments regarding interceptions refer to your closing down settings

AM comment of 'Player X is getting skinned' refers to your tackling setting for that player - if he's getting skinned then reduce tackling

These may not necessarily help your game, they have to be used in the overall context of your tactic and the way you want to play - but I can guarantee that once implemented the AM will stay quiet!

Being 'skinned' can happen in two ways:

1) the defender attempts a tackle and misses allowing the attacker to dribble past him

2) the defender is severly inferior in terms of raw pace and the attacker is able to knock the ball into space and sprint past the defender.

Easier tackling encourages your player to stay on his feet rather than commit to a tackle which reduces the likelihood of the first case. The second case is addressed by selecting players with comparible physical attributes to their opponent.

The AM comment of 'Player X is being skinned' refers most commonly to the first case. I often see this comment raised against my wingers who have high acceleration + pace and low tackling attributes. Reducing their tackling to easy removes this comment from the AM feedback.
